Expression of CD40 in spleen in cirrhotic portal hypertension and its clinical significance / 中华肝胆外科杂志

ABSTRACT
ObjectiveTo investigate the expression and clinical significance of CD40 in the spleen of cirrhotic portal hypertension. MethodsExpression of CD40 was determined with S-P immunohistochemistry in spleen specimens from 50 cases of cirrhotic portal hypertension and 15 healthy individuals. ResultsThe CD40 positive rates in normal spleen and cirrhotic spleen were 86.7% and 36.0%, respectively. There was a significant difference between the 2 groups (P<0.05). There was a negative correlation between the expression of CD40 and Child grades of liver function and cirrhotic splenic types(P<0. 05). Conclusion CD40 might reflect the changes of splenic immune function,which might be one of more exact clinical examination indexes of splenic immune function.
